**Alert: TokenLoop refresh storm (Vexhall Auth).** Heads up — this fires when session-token refresh requests spike above baseline, usually meaning the refresh-before-expiry logic is retrying in a tight loop. Before approving any auth-path change, check whether it touches the backoff constants; that's what caused the last storm. Triage steps, dashboards, and the known-bad commit list are on the internal page below.

wiki page, bagaf-fawip: https://harbor.tolvaqsys.local/pages/repo/pages/secrets/eac969ffc71f356b

## Changelog — Tidemark Widget 3.2

Defaults changed. Read before touching anything.

- Refresh interval now hourly, not every 15 min. Harbor feeds from the Pellisport aggregator throttle aggressive polling.
- Lunar-offset correction is on by default. Disable only for legacy Kestrel Bay deployments.
- Chart units default to metric. The imperial fallback flag is deprecated and will be removed in 3.4.
- Cache eviction is now time-based, not size-based.

New installs should start from the default configuration values listed below.

config for kahap-taweg:
oliox:
  pin: 8609
  tenant: casath
  seal: seal_632a4a6f
  metrics_host: metrics.oliox.nelvrogrid.example
  standby_team: keleth
  escalation: briiel-oliwyn
  nonce: e2397c

Ticket: SUP-889 — Expired credential blocking reset flow revamp

The revamped password reset flow on Quenchly staging is failing: the token-issuer credential expired yesterday, so reset emails never send. Users see a generic error. Credential has been rotated; support can resume testing once configs update. The replacement key is below.

gateway credential: kto23_LX9A4ys6i4nzHtpOLNLodKK

Welcome to the Netherquill gateway team. We disable per-message deflate on Fenwick-tier websocket channels: compression saves ~30% bandwidth but exposes us to context-takeover risks and inflates memory per connection. Review the tradeoff matrix before changing defaults. Audit access to the compression config requires unsealing the Oxhollow policy vault, and the on-call reviewer does that with the recovery passphrase noted immediately below this paragraph.

vault phrase of yagag-kadup = belael-druius-rusax-kelox